Review from Jenn C.
I don't know any other Greek food stores in town (haven't been to any, at least), so I don't know if Hellas Foods is as good as it gets. But it is pretty freakin' good. As others have mentioned, they have fantastic spanakopita (sp?) and a good selection of olives. In addition to their homemade tzatziki, they also have a fantastic hummus, as well as other yummy spreads. They also stock my favourite cheese - halloumi (cheaper than at Save on Foods), which is a salty and squeaky cheese, not unlike cheese curds, but the coolest thing about it is that it can withstand high temperatures - you can grill it and it melts but holds its shape, and you can serve it alongside your Greek chicken, pork, or whatever. Soooo good!

Review from Jennifer P.
Edmonton, AB
At Hellas, the spanakopita, hummus, tzatziki, olives, olive oil, greek coffee, baklava ....and, god, did I mention the spanakopita ... are to die for! I'll pop in sometimes to this authentic Greek grocer when I'm starving and in need of a filo pastry fix. Their crispy pie is filled with a savoury, moist mix of spinach and feta goodness. I've honestly never tasted better! And it's a dirt cheap lunch at $3.49 They have a little toaster over to heat it up for you right there. It doesn't work very well, but even luke warm it's still the best I've ever had. This is a great place to pick up crackers and dips for appetizer plates if you're entertaining and want a little something different than cheese and crackers. The baklava is sweet and sticky and it's impossible to have only one, so beware!

Review from Maria F.
This Greek grocery store has been up and running for a long time, so I guess despite the fact that the selection of food here is limited, the business is going great. I don't shop here regularly but I occassionaly stop by to purchase spanakopita (highly recommended!) and their home-made tzatziki. On the shelves you will find olive oil, various sauces and Greek style desserts such as cakes and cookies. The fridge houses olives, several kinds of meat and feta cheese. As you can see, not a lot of food is sold here, really. Italian Centre Shop is way better than this little store. However, I think that if you live close to 124 street where Hellas is located, this grocery store is convenient to have nearby.
